What does a modeling job involve?

A modeling job involves representing products, clothing, or concepts for companies, photographers, or designers, typically through photo shoots, runway shows, or advertising campaigns. Models use their appearance, poses, and expressions to help promote or sell products and ideas. The profession may require travel, maintaining a certain appearance, and working closely with creative teams. Modeling can be divided into different types such as fashion, commercial, fitness, and editorial modeling, each with its own requirements and opportunities.

Can a 5'4" girl model?

In modeling, height requirements vary by industry and market segment. While high fashion runway models typically are around 5'9" to 6', commercial and print modeling often have more flexible height standards, and a 5'4" model can find opportunities in these areas. Building a strong portfolio and demonstrating versatility can help models of different heights succeed in various modeling niches.

Job description

Job Details:Job Description: 

This role operates at the intersection of architecture, technology, and business strategy, influencing Intel's product roadmaps and key technical tradeoffs across client and server platforms.

As a Power and Performance Architect, you will define and optimize systemlevel power and performance targets, collaborating closely with IP, SoC, platform, and software engineers using workloaddriven methodologies.

The role requires strong systemlevel thinking, deep technical judgment, and the ability to lead and influence across organizations while engaging senior technical and executive leadership.

Key Responsibilities

  • Drive systemlevel PnP projections by defining representative workload models, characterizing workloads, and evaluating architectural tradeoffs across CPU, GPU, memory, fabrics, and platforms.
  • Develop and own longterm power and performance models for CPU, GPU, memory IPs, and full SoC and evolve them to support early pathfinding and comparative analysis.
  • Define power and performance targets and drive execution to achieve aggressive power goals across development phases, from pathfinding to silicon, balancing technology constraints and market requirements.
  • Develop, maintain, and enhance power and performance modeling tools, flows, and methodologies to enable fast iteration and sensitivity analysis.
  • Identify emerging technology and market trends, risks, and opportunities impacting competitiveness including evolving workload characteristics.
  • Provide actionable, datadriven recommendations to architecture, planning, marketing, and executive leadership that influence product direction and roadmap decisions.
  • Collaborate crossfunctionally with architecture, design, postsilicon, platform, and business teams to ensure systemlevel power and performance goals are met.

Successful candidates are impactdriven collaborators who work effectively in ambiguous environments, learn quickly, and translate complex system behavior into measurable results.

Qualifications:

Minimum Qualifications

  • B.Sc. / M.Sc. / PhD in Electrical Engineering, Computer Engineering, or a related field with 4+ years of relevant experience in system, SoC, or architectural roles.
  • Advanced understanding of SoC behavior and power and performance modeling across compute, memory hierarchy, and interconnects.
  • Experience in workload modeling, workload characterization, or workload abstraction.
  • Highly selfmotivated, able to operate independently and drive initiatives to completion in ambiguous problem spaces.
  • Strong problemsolving skills and attention to detail in modeling assumptions and data quality.
  • In this highly visible role, excellent communication and presentation skills are required to engage senior technical and executive audiences.

Preferred Qualifications

  • Experience with Python or scripting languages to develop and maintain analysis tools, flows, and methodologies or modeling frameworks.
  • Strong understanding of architecture, RTL, structural design (SD), validation, and postsilicon processes with the ability to reason across abstraction levels.
  • Experience with Intel IPs and full product development lifecycles.
  • Expertise in power and performance analysis, systemlevel tradeoffs, and power reduction techniques including scalability evaluation.
  • Handson experience with postsilicon performance and power measurement, validation, and analysis and correlation back to models.
  • Background in highperformance computing, graphics, or AI accelerator workloads.
  • Experience in semiconductor physics and process technology and their impact on power and performance.
  • Proven ability to lead complex, crossfunctional technical initiatives with measurable business impact.
  • Demonstrated success in competitive analysis, market assessment, and longterm roadmap planning.
  • Knowledge of business marketing strategies and competitive positioning to inform technical tradeoffs.
  • Experience in developing and maintaining or institutionalizing analysis tools, flows, and methodologies.
